Kailasapuram is a township located 17 km (11 mi) from Tiruchirapalli in Tamil Nadu, India. It contains the manufacturing and housing of Bharat Heavy Electricals Limited (BHEL) as part of BHEL's 3,000-acre (12 km2) Tiruchirapalli Complex.[1]

Kailasapuram has 2 temples(Ganesha and Balaji),a mosque and a church. Recently a Kamarajar statue has been opened at Ganesa point near kailasapuram.

The township is maintained by civil township department of the company that covers nearly 2500 quarters.

Facilities

Housing

It is broadly divided into sectors namely A,B,C,D,E,Nehru Nagar,R,PH and K. The PH,Nehru nagar and K are a little away from Kailasapuram and is called Kamarajapuram. There are major shopping centers in A,C,B and K sectors. The quarters are also divided into Type 2,3,4,5,6 and the Executive Directors Bungalow. Guest Houses

Kailasapuram has 3 guest houses namely the Kailash guest house, the Rockfort Guest House (WRI Hostel) and the Kaveri guest house

K C Club

Kailasapuram Club (located within the BHEL Township premises) is an elite Club that has been serving the entertainment needs of the BHEL Executive fraternity and its families. It houses the following facilities: The Library, The Reading room, The Restaurant, The Modern Gymnasium, Swimming Pool, Billiards and Snooker, Table Tennis Room, Open Air Theater, Badminton(Ball) Court, Skating Rink, Banquet Halls and Lawns and Children's Park

Stadium

Kailasapuram has a huge stadium called the Jawaharlal Nehru Stadium where the 1989 Ranji Trophy matches were held.A vivid sports culture is established through the statdium.Parade function is organised every year on 26 th January and 15 th August with full enthusiasm.All schools under BHEL trichy unit and security force of BHEL take part in it.The ED of the unit, gives speeches to the audience including company's highlights with present and future plans associated.

Location

Kailasapuram is about 5 km (3 mi) from Grand Anaicut also known as "Kallanai", which is one of the oldest man made dams in the world, on the river Cauvery.Kailasapuram has its own waterworks in a place called Vengur close to the Kaveri river.

Kailasapuram is easily accessible by road, rail and air situated just 14 km (9 mi) from the centre of Tiruchirapalli City on the Tiruchi-Thanjavur highway and a short distance from the Tiruverumbur railway station, the township is well connected by road and rail. Tiruchirapalli also has an airport catering to both domestic and international flights.
